1-(Pyridin-2-yl)piperidin-4-one is a versatile compound that finds wide application in chemical synthesis. It serves as a valuable building block in the preparation of various p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and fine chemicals. Due to its unique structural characteristics, this compound can participate in a variety of chemical reactions, enabling the synthesis of complex molecules with diverse functionalities. In organic synthesis, 1-(Pyridin-2-yl)piperidin-4-one acts as a key intermediate for the construction of heterocyclic compounds and can undergo functional group transformations to introduce desired properties into target molecules. Its presence in the molecular structure imparts specific biological activities, making it a valuable tool for drug discovery and development efforts. In summary, the strategic incorporation of 1-(Pyridin-2-yl)piperidin-4-one into synthetic pathways enables chemists to access a wide range of structurally diverse compounds with potential applications in various fields.
